06/15/2021 ROBERT SHERRY MECHANICAL-COMMERCIAL REVIEW Reqs Change 1. Footnote b on Table 403.3.1.1, IMC 2018 states that mechanical exhaust is required for the kitchen and no air from the kitchen may be recirculated to any other space. Reference: Section 403.2.1 (3), IMC 2018.
2. The addition of the Type I grease hood to the suite has resulted in the suite having 750 CFM more exhaust flow than make up air flow. Show how adequate make-up air is to be provided to the room so that the room pressure remains essentially neutral. Reference: Section 501.4, IMC 2018.
3. Show that combustible materials (e.g. wood studs) are not located within 18” of the Type I hood. Reference: Section 507.2.6, IMC 2018.

06/24/2021 ERIC NEWCOMB BUILDING-COMMERCIAL REVIEW Reqs Change 1. Sheet A1; Code Review: The Code Review indicates this is a retail occupancy group with no change from the previous use. From the floor plan on Sheet A3, it appears the majority of this tenant space is for food preparation and food service. The addition of a new hood would support that determination. Please revise the Code Review for an A-2 Occupancy Classification.
